Do you guys wet mop your meat?  If so, how often?

- Torg
Depends on my final product. 

Dry ribs or butts I do not, I believe that smoked meat should be dry rubbed on the outside but don't misinterpret that as dry meat at all.  It falls apart juicy! 

I cook half time in the smoke for flavor and then wrap in foil for the 2nd  half. 

Wife does request bbq sauce on some items near the end...

I never inject either and hate liquid smoke

Do you guys wet mop your meat?  If so, how often?

- Torg

I do not. High maintenance.

Most that wet mop use the offset wood smokers that are a somewhat dry heat and the wet mop helps.
